Safestore Holdings plc
Safestore is the UK's largest self-storage group with 210 stores on 31 July 2025; comprising 139 in the UK (including 78 in London and the South East with the remainder in key metropolitan areas such as Manchester, Birmingham, Glasgow, Edinburgh, Liverpool, Sheffield, Leeds, Newcastle, and Bristol), 32 in the Paris region, 16 in Spain, 16 in the Netherlands and seven in Belgium. Safestore Holdings plc (SFSHF) - Net Assets
Latest net assets as of October 2025: $2.29 Billion USD
Based on the latest financial reports, Safestore Holdings plc (SFSHF) has net assets worth $2.29 Billion USD as of October 2025.
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($3.59 Billion) and total liabilities ($1.30 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.

Equity Growth Attribution
This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Safestore Holdings plc's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.
Equity Growth Insights
- From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 2,226,800,000 to 2,290,029,784, a change of 63,229,784 (2.8%).
- Net income of 111,179,124 contributed positively to equity growth.
- Dividend payments of 66,647,431 reduced retained earnings.
- Other comprehensive income increased equity by 15,109,043.
